Types of Caulk and Their Drying Times

Selecting the appropriate caulk for your project can significantly impact the outcome. Familiarizing yourself with the various types of caulk and their respective drying times will empower you to achieve a polished finish and ensure long-lasting results. Below, we explore different caulk varieties and the timeframes you can expect for drying, enabling you to make well-informed choices for your home improvement endeavors.

1. Acrylic Latex Caulk

Acrylic latex caulk is favored for interior applications due to its user-friendly nature and compatibility with paint. It excels in sealing gaps around baseboards, window frames, and door frames.

  • Drying Time: Generally dries to the touch in approximately 30 minutes and fully cures within 24 hours.
  • Best For: Indoor projects, particularly those requiring paint.

2. Silicone Caulk

Renowned for its flexibility and water resistance, silicone caulk is ideal for moisture-prone areas such as bathrooms and kitchens.

  • Drying Time: Takes about 30 minutes to become skin-like, with complete curing taking up to 48 hours.
  • Best For: Wet areas like showers, tubs, and sinks.

3. Polyurethane Caulk

Polyurethane caulk is celebrated for its strong adhesion and durability, making it suitable for both indoor and outdoor applications. It’s particularly effective for sealing joints and gaps in concrete, brick, and metal.

  • Drying Time: Dries to the touch in about 24 hours, with full curing taking up to 7 days.
  • Best For: Heavy-duty applications, including exterior projects and areas subject to movement.

4. Butyl Rubber Caulk

Butyl rubber caulk is highly flexible and waterproof, making it an excellent choice for outdoor use and environments exposed to severe weather.

  • Drying Time: Typically dries to the touch within 2-3 hours and cures fully in about 7-14 days.
  • Best For: Roofs, gutters, and other exterior applications.

5. Fireproof Caulk

Fireproof caulk is specifically designed to withstand high temperatures, making it crucial for sealing around fireplaces, chimneys, and other heat-generating appliances.

  • Drying Time: Requires about 30 minutes to dry to the touch and up to 72 hours for complete curing.
  • Best For: Areas exposed to high heat.

Factors Influencing Caulk Drying Time

Understanding the general drying times of various caulks is just the beginning; several factors can significantly impact how quickly they set quickly or slowly the caulk dries. By recognizing these elements, you can better plan your projects and achieve optimal results. Let’s delve into the primary factors that affect caulk drying time.

1. Temperature

The temperature at which caulk is applied is crucial to its drying process. Warmer conditions typically expedite drying, while cooler environments can hinder it. For best outcomes:

  • Ideal Temperature Range: Most caulks perform optimally between 50°F and 80°F (10°C to 27°C).
  • Tip: Steer clear of applying caulk in extreme temperatures, as this can adversely affect its effectiveness and longevity.

2. Humidity

Humidity levels also play a significant role in the drying speed of caulk. Elevated humidity can prolong the drying time, whereas lower humidity can enhance it. Keep these points in mind:

  • Optimal Humidity: Aim for humidity levels between 40% and 60% for the best drying results.
  • Tip: In high-humidity settings, consider utilizing a dehumidifier to regulate moisture levels.

3. Thickness of Application

The thickness of the caulk application directly impacts drying time caulk bead directly impacts its drying time. Thicker layers will naturally take longer to dry compared to thinner applications. To optimize drying:

  • Recommended Thickness: Apply caulk in layers no thicker than 1/4 inch (6 mm) to promote even drying.
  • Tip: For deeper gaps, use multiple thin layers, allowing each to dry before adding the next.

4. Type of Surface

The nature of the surface where caulk is applied can also affect drying time. Porous materials, such as wood or concrete, may absorb moisture from the caulk, accelerating the drying process, while non-porous surfaces like metal or glass may slow it down.

  • Surface Preparation: Ensure all surfaces are clean, dry, and free from dust or grease to enhance adhesion and drying.
  • Tip: Consider using a primer on porous surfaces to create a more uniform base for the caulk.

5. Air Circulation

Effective air circulation can significantly expedite the drying of caulk by promoting moisture evaporation. Conversely, poor ventilation can extend drying times.

  • Enhancing Airflow: Utilize fans or open windows to improve air circulation in the workspace.
  • Tip: Avoid applying caulk in enclosed areas lacking adequate ventilation.

Signs That Caulk is Ready for Painting

Determining when caulk is ready for painting is essential for achieving a polished and professional finish. If you apply paint too early, you risk poor adhesion, uneven surfaces, and a compromised seal. Below, we outline the key signs that indicate your caulk has dried and cured properly, making it suitable for that final coat of paint.

1. Dry to the Touch

The initial sign that caulk is ready for painting is when it feels dry to the touch. This indicates that the surface has set and is no longer tacky. Here’s how to assess this:

  • Touch Test: Lightly press your finger against the caulk. If it feels solid and does not stick, it has likely dried adequately on the surface.
  • Timeframe: This typically occurs within 30 minutes to an hour, though it can vary based on the type of caulk and environmental conditions.

2. Uniform Color

A consistent color change is another sign that caulk is ready. As it dries, the caulk may become more opaque or lighter. Look for the following:

  • Consistent Appearance: Ensure that the entire bead of caulk displays a uniform color without any wet or darker areas.
  • Visual Inspection: Examine the caulk line closely to confirm that the color is even throughout.

3. Full Cure Time

While the caulk may feel dry, allowing it to cure fully is crucial for optimal durability and adhesion. Curing times can differ:

  1. Manufacturer’s Guidelines: Always refer to the product label for specific curing times, which can range from 24 hours to several days.
  2. Patience is Key: Even if the caulk feels dry, adhering to the full recommended curing time will yield the best results.

4. No Movement or Flex

Caulk that has completely cured will not shift or flex when pressed. To verify this:

  • Press Test: Apply gentle pressure along the caulk line. If it remains firm and shows no signs of movement, it is ready for painting.
  • Consistency Check: Ensure that the entire length of the caulk behaves consistently during the test.

5. No Residual Odor

Some caulks may emit a noticeable odor while curing. A lack of any lingering smell can indicate that the curing process is complete:

  • Sniff Test: If the caulk area no longer has a strong chemical scent, it’s a positive sign that it has fully cured.
  • Ventilation: Ensure proper ventilation during the drying process to help dissipate any remaining odors.

Avoiding Common Pitfalls

Painting Prematurely

Applying paint over caulk before it has fully dried and cured can lead to numerous complications that jeopardize the integrity and lifespan of your project. This section will explore the potential pitfalls of premature painting, the warning signs to be aware of, and strategies to circumvent these issues. By recognizing the risks and following recommended practices, you can achieve a polished and lasting finish.

Possible Complications

Hastily painting over caulk can lead to several problematic outcomes. Here are some frequent issues that may arise:

  • Poor Adhesion: Inadequately cured caulk may prevent paint from adhering correctly, resulting in peeling or flaking as time goes on.
  • Uneven Appearance: If the caulk remains wet or tacky, the paint may dry unevenly, leading to streaks or bubbles that detract from the overall look.
  • Cracking and Shrinking: As the caulk continues to cure beneath the paint, it may shrink or crack, creating visible flaws in the painted surface.
  • Weakened Seal: Premature painting can hinder the caulk’s ability to create a proper seal, diminishing its effectiveness and durability.

Indicators That Caulk Is Unprepared

To prevent these issues, it’s essential to identify signs that the caulk is not yet ready for painting. Watch for these indicators:

  1. Tacky Texture: If the caulk feels sticky or tacky when touched, it has not dried adequately.
  2. Color Variation: Wet or partially dried caulk may exhibit darker or inconsistent coloration.
  3. Softness: Gently pressing on the caulk should not leave an indentation. If it does, the caulk remains too soft.
  4. Odor: A strong lingering smell can suggest that the caulk is still in the curing process and not ready for paint.

Choosing the Right Caulk for Your Project

Selecting the correct caulk is essential for achieving a durable and professional finish. Opting for an unsuitable caulk can lead to a range of problems, including poor adhesion and ineffective sealing, which can ultimately undermine the integrity of your work. This section will guide guide you through the challenges associated with using the wrong caulk and offer insights on how to make informed choices tailored to your specific project requirements.

Common Problems with Incorrect Caulk Selection

Using the wrong type of caulk can result in various issues that compromise both functionality and aesthetics. Here are some frequent challenges:

  • Poor Adhesion: Incompatible caulk may fail to bond effectively with surfaces, leading to peeling or separation over time.
  • Lack of Flexibility: Certain caulks may not provide the necessary flexibility for areas subject to movement, resulting in cracks and gaps.
  • Water Resistance: Employing non-waterproof caulk in moisture-prone areas can cause water damage and promote mold growth.
  • Paint Compatibility: Not all caulks accept paint; using non-paintable options can lead to paint peeling or flaking.

Guidelines for Selecting the Right Caulk

Choosing the appropriate caulk requires an understanding of your project’s specific needs and the characteristics of various caulk types. Keep these factors in mind:

  1. Project Location: Assess whether your project is indoors or outdoors, as this will dictate the type of caulk needed.
    • Indoor Projects: Acrylic latex caulk is typically ideal for interior tasks due to its ease of use and paint compatibility.
    • Outdoor Projects: For exterior applications, polyurethane caulk is preferred for its durability and strong adhesion to diverse surfaces.
  2. Moisture Exposure: Identify areas that will encounter water or high humidity.
    • Wet Areas: Silicone caulk is optimal for bathrooms and kitchens, offering excellent water resistance.
    • Dry Areas: Acrylic latex caulk is suitable for dry environments where moisture resistance is less critical.
  3. Surface Material: Consider the materials you will be caulking.
    • Porous Surfaces: Polyurethane caulk adheres effectively to porous materials like wood and concrete.
    • Non-Porous Surfaces: Silicone caulk is ideal for non-porous surfaces such as glass and metal.
  4. Paintability: Determine whether the caulk will need to be painted.
    • Paintable Caulks: Acrylic latex and silicone-acrylic blends are paintable and suitable for projects requiring a finished appearance.
    • Non-Paintable Caulks: Pure silicone caulk is generally not paintable and should be reserved for areas where painting is unnecessary.

Steps to Use Heat as an Accelerant

Employing heat is one of the most efficient methods to accelerate caulk drying. Follow these steps for optimal results:

  1. Prepare the Area: Ensure the caulk is applied evenly and smoothly, clearing away any dust or debris.
  2. Choose the Right Tool: Select a heat gun or hairdryer, setting it to low or medium heat to avoid damaging the caulk.
  3. Maintain Distance: Keep the heat source approximately 12 inches away from the caulked area to prevent overheating.
  4. Move Consistently: Glide the heat source back and forth evenly across the caulk line to distribute heat uniformly.
  5. Monitor Progress: Regularly check the caulk to ensure it is drying properly without any signs of cracking or shrinking.
